博客 指标归因分析的技术实现与数据建模方法

指标归因分析的技术实现与数据建模方法

   数栈君   发表于 2026-03-09 12:12  62  0

在数字化转型的浪潮中,企业越来越依赖数据驱动的决策。指标归因分析作为一种重要的数据分析方法,帮助企业从复杂的业务数据中识别关键驱动因素,优化资源配置,提升运营效率。本文将深入探讨指标归因分析的技术实现与数据建模方法,为企业提供实用的指导。


什么是指标归因分析?

指标归因分析(Metric Attributions Analysis)是一种通过分析多个因素对业务指标的影响,确定每个因素贡献度的方法。简单来说,它帮助企业回答“哪些因素对业务结果影响最大?”的问题。

例如,电商企业可以通过指标归因分析,确定广告投放、用户留存率、产品转化率等因素对销售额的贡献度。这种方法在市场营销、产品优化、用户行为分析等领域具有广泛的应用。


指标归因分析的核心技术实现

指标归因分析的技术实现依赖于数据处理、建模和可视化等多方面的支持。以下是其实现的关键步骤:

1. 数据收集与预处理

  • 数据来源:指标归因分析需要多源数据的支持,包括用户行为数据(如点击、转化)、产品数据(如库存、价格)、市场数据(如广告投放、促销活动)等。
  • 数据清洗:对收集到的数据进行去重、补全和格式统一,确保数据的完整性和准确性。
  • 特征工程:根据业务需求,提取关键特征。例如,用户特征(如年龄、性别)、行为特征(如访问频率)、时间特征(如节假日)等。

2. 模型选择与训练

指标归因分析的核心是建立数学模型,量化各因素对目标指标的贡献。以下是常用的建模方法:

(1)线性回归模型

  • 原理:线性回归通过最小二乘法拟合目标变量与多个自变量之间的线性关系,计算各自变量的系数,反映其对目标变量的贡献。
  • 优点:简单易懂,计算效率高。
  • 缺点:假设变量间存在线性关系,可能无法捕捉复杂的非线性关系。

(2)机器学习模型

  • 随机森林:通过构建多个决策树,计算每个特征的重要性得分。
  • 梯度提升树(如XGBoost、LightGBM):利用树模型的可解释性,评估特征对目标变量的贡献。
  • 神经网络:适用于复杂非线性关系的场景,但解释性较差。

(3)时间序列分析

  • ARIMA模型:用于分析时间序列数据,识别各因素对目标指标的影响。
  • 状态空间模型:通过动态模型捕捉变量间的相互作用。

(4)因果推断模型

  • 倾向评分匹配(Propensity Score Matching, PSM):用于评估因果关系,控制混杂变量的影响。
  • DID(双重差分法):通过比较处理组和对照组的变化,评估政策或干预措施的效果。

3. 结果解释与可视化

  • 贡献度可视化:通过图表(如柱状图、折线图)展示各因素对目标指标的贡献度。
  • 交互式分析:使用数据可视化工具(如Tableau、Power BI)进行交互式分析,帮助用户深入探索数据。
  • 可解释性报告:生成报告,解释模型结果的业务意义,为企业决策提供支持。

数据建模方法的详细探讨

1. 线性回归模型

线性回归是指标归因分析中最常用的建模方法之一。其基本假设是目标变量与自变量之间存在线性关系。以下是其实现步骤:

(1)数据准备

  • 确定目标变量(如销售额)和自变量(如广告支出、用户点击量)。
  • 对数据进行标准化或归一化处理,确保各变量具有可比性。

(2)模型训练

  • 使用最小二乘法拟合线性回归模型,计算各自变量的系数。
  • 通过R²值评估模型的拟合优度。

(3)结果解释

  • 系数的符号和大小反映了自变量对目标变量的影响方向和程度。
  • 例如,广告支出系数为正,说明广告支出增加会提高销售额。

(4)案例应用

假设某电商企业希望分析广告投放对销售额的影响,可以使用线性回归模型,将广告支出作为自变量,销售额作为目标变量。模型结果可能显示广告支出对销售额的贡献度为30%。


2. 机器学习模型

机器学习模型在处理复杂关系时具有显著优势。以下是几种常用模型的实现方法:

(1)随机森林

  • 原理:随机森林通过构建多棵决策树,并对结果进行投票或平均,提高模型的准确性和鲁棒性。
  • 特征重要性:通过特征重要性评分,量化各特征对目标变量的贡献。

(2)梯度提升树

  • 原理:梯度提升树通过迭代优化,逐步拟合数据的残差,提升模型性能。
  • 可解释性:通过特征重要性得分,评估各特征对目标变量的影响。

(3)神经网络

  • 原理:神经网络通过多层非线性变换,捕捉数据中的复杂关系。
  • 挑战:神经网络的解释性较差,难以直接量化各因素的贡献度。

3. 时间序列分析

时间序列分析适用于具有时间依赖性的数据。以下是其实现方法:

(1)ARIMA模型

  • 原理:ARIMA模型通过自回归(AR)和移动平均(MA)组件,拟合时间序列数据。
  • 应用:用于分析广告投放、用户行为等时间序列数据对目标指标的影响。

(2)状态空间模型

  • 原理:状态空间模型通过隐含状态和观测数据的关系,捕捉变量间的相互作用。
  • 应用:适用于分析复杂动态系统的指标归因。

4. 因果推断模型

因果推断模型在指标归因分析中具有重要意义。以下是其实现方法:

(1)倾向评分匹配(PSM)

  • 原理:通过计算倾向评分,匹配处理组和对照组,控制混杂变量的影响。
  • 应用:用于评估广告投放、促销活动等干预措施的效果。

(2)双重差分法(DID)

  • 原理:通过比较处理组和对照组在干预前后的变化,评估干预措施的效果。
  • 应用:适用于政策评估、产品优化等场景。

指标归因分析的挑战与解决方案

1. 数据质量

  • 挑战:数据缺失、噪声、偏差可能影响模型的准确性。
  • 解决方案:通过数据清洗、特征工程等方法,提高数据质量。

2. 模型选择

  • 挑战:不同场景下,模型的适用性不同。
  • 解决方案:根据业务需求和数据特征,选择合适的模型。

3. 可解释性

  • 挑战:复杂模型(如神经网络)的可解释性较差。
  • 解决方案:使用线性回归、随机森林等可解释性较强的模型。

指标归因分析的应用场景

1. 数据中台

数据中台是企业数据资产的中枢,支持多维度的数据分析。指标归因分析可以与数据中台结合,提供实时的业务洞察。

2. 数字孪生

数字孪生通过虚拟模型反映现实世界的状态,指标归因分析可以帮助企业优化数字孪生模型的性能。

3. 数字可视化

指标归因分析的结果可以通过数字可视化工具(如Tableau、Power BI)展示,帮助用户直观理解数据。


申请试用&https://www.dtstack.com/?src=bbs

如果您希望进一步了解指标归因分析的技术实现与数据建模方法,可以申请试用相关工具,探索更多可能性。申请试用


通过本文的介绍,您应该对指标归因分析的技术实现与数据建模方法有了全面的了解。无论是数据中台、数字孪生还是数字可视化,指标归因分析都能为企业提供有力的支持。希望本文能为您提供有价值的参考,帮助您在数字化转型中取得更大的成功。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料